___ means paying attention to the present moment.
What is mindfulness?
___ are clear limits on what behaviors you will accept from others, reducing the likelihood of feeling overwhelmed, disrespected, or taken advantage of.
What are boundaries?
This type of thinking involves believing things are either right or wrong, good or bad.
What is all or nothing thinking OR what is black or white thinking?
___ are intrusive, distressing thoughts that create anxiety or discomfort.
What is obsessions?
___ ___ is when we use feelings alone to determine our decisions and behaviors.
What is the emotional mind?
Social ___ is a common symptom of depression.
What is isolation?
A communication style in which a person stands up for their own needs and wants while also taking into consideration the needs and wants of others.
What is assertive communication?
Assuming we know what other people are thinking without looking at the evidence.
What is mind reading?
___ are actions or mental rituals aimed at reducing the uncomfortable feelings caused by obsessions.
What are compulsions?
___ ___ is when we recognize and respect our feelings while responding to them in a rational way.
What is wise mind?
When you practice ___ regularly, it can gently shift your focus away from negative thoughts and help you notice the good things in your life, even when things feel challenging.
What is gratitude?
A communication style in which a person prioritizes the needs, wants, and feelings of others, even at their own expense.
What is passive communcation?
Making broad interpretations from a single or few events.
What is overgeneralization?

___ ___ is when we use only logic, ignoring our feelings.
What is reasonable mind?
___ ___ ___ is tensing and relaxing the muscles throughout your body.
What is progressive muscle relaxation?
___ means retreating into your shell in order to avoid an argument.
What is stonewalling?
Assuming bad things will happen in the future.
What is fortune telling?
___ ___ is an effective form of treatment in helping individuals face fears and resist rituals in a gradual, supportive way.
What is exposure therapy?
___ ___ means accepting something fully, both mentally and emotionally. It does not require liking or approving of something.
What is radical acceptance?
___-___ is an technique that enhances your well-being and replenishes your mind and body.
What is self-care?
___ ___ refer to how people think about and behave in relationships. They are established in childhood and strongly impact relationships throughout life.
What are attachment styles?
The belief that you are responsible for events outside of your control.
What is personalization?
